Families Confirm Human Remains Belong to Missing Children

 

REXBURG, ID — After authorities confirmed the human remains found in Chad Daybell’s backyard belong to children, the families of JJ Vallow and Tylee Ryan have confirmed the remains belong to the missing kids.

According to KUTV, the family members of both children confirmed the tragic news in a joint statement. 

“The Woodcock’s and The Ryan’s are confirming that the human remains by law enforcement on Chad Daybell’s property are indeed our beloved JJ and Tylee. We are filled with unfathomable sadness that these two bright stars were stolen from us, and only hope that they died without pain or suffering. Official statements from the Rexburg Police, the Medical Examiner, and the FBI will be released soon. We ask that you respect our family’s privacy while we grieve – we have only just been told of the loss of our loved ones and need time to process. We are not granting interviews at this time and hope you all understand that this is the worst new we will ever get in our lives and want to be left alone for the time being. Thank you.”

Tylee was last seen on September 8 when she took a trip with her mother, brother, and uncle to Yellowstone National Park. JJ was last seen on September 23, the last day he attended school.

The official search for Tylee and JJ began on November 27, 2019, after a welfare check on JJ made police suspicious. By December 20, 2019, the Rexburg Police Department went public with the search for the children. On February 20 Lori Daybell was arrested in Kauai and was charged with two felony counts of desertion and nonsupport of dependent children in connection to the case.

On March 5 Lori was extradited to Rexburg, Idaho. On June 9, authorities served the warrant that allowed them to search the home of Chad Daybell, and the next day Chad was charged with two counts of felony destruction, alteration, or concealment of evidence. Both Lori and Chad remain in jail with a $1 million bond.

The results of the autopsy have not been released and as of this time no further charges have been filed against Lori and Chad Daybell.
